This position is responsible for:

Answers the telephone in a courteous manner and directs calls to the appropriate destination; records accurate and complete messages when necessary; receives and receipts deliveries and donations; greets and announces visitors and clients; provides general information about The Salvation Army's operations and services; performs routine clerical work such as typing and filing.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Answers the telephone and transfers calls to the appropriate destination; responds to caller's questions and provides accurate information.
  • Telephones others to communicate messages; records accurate and complete messages; ensures the timely and accurate distribution of messages through telephone and/or E-mail.
  • Receives, greets and announces visitors in a courteous and tactful manner; provides assistance to callers and visitors by answering questions and providing instructions and referrals; screens sales representative soliciting to The Salvation Army.
  • Notifies proper individuals when visitors or clients have arrived; ensures that visitors and clients have signed in.
  • Performs other administrative duties as requested.

Physical Requirements and

Working Conditions:

  • Ability to meet attendance requirements.
  • Ability to read, write and communicate the English language effectively.
  • Ability to operate a telephone and/or switchboard.
  • Ability to sort documents alphabetically and numerically.
  • Duties are usually performed seated. Sitting may be relieved by brief or occasional periods of standing or walking.
  • Moderate amount of physical effort required associated with walking, standing, lifting and carrying light to moderately heavy objects (25-50 lbs.) frequently.
